"Even when the business began to earn large profits, I still saved my money like Scrooge,'Miranda said."

In 1-2 sentences, explain how a reader might interpret this allusion. Use details from the sentence to support your ideas.

A reader might interpret this allusion as meaning that even though Miranda's business was successful, she continued to be frugal and careful with her money, similar to the character Scrooge from Charles Dickens' "A Christmas Carol." This suggests that Miranda values financial stability and isn't easily swayed by material wealth or success.
